Bell County reported its first death as a result of COVID-19 infection Thursday.

The patient was a woman in her 80's from Temple. Her identity has not been made public.

“Out of respect for the family of the deceased and to assure compliance with federal medical privacy rules, the Bell County Public Health District will identify when a death related to COVID-19 occurs but will not release any additional information such as city of residence or age range, unless the family specifically permits," Bell County Public District Director Dr. Amanda Robison-Chadwell said.

Health officials currently report 20 confirmed cases of COVID-19 in Bell County, 1 case in Coryell County, 28 in McLennan County, 1 in Falls County, 2 in Milam County, 27 in Williamson County, and 1 in Burnet County.

Bell County Remains under a shelter in place directive, with residents asked not to leave their homes unless it is absolutely necessary, to continue practicing social distancing, and to wash their hands thoroughly and frequently.
